Output 05a59f29a76f7eef8b9c89fadb132b6efb45c6e0d3893e657f1381970ee9aa6e:1

value
22020803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1f847f080e49565651230b2b4fef82130b391ee OP_EQUAL
address
3KNdmS99frE7TqLAXFdwBBZanwMdcoXg9r
transaction
05a59f29a76f7eef8b9c89fadb132b6efb45c6e0d3893e657f1381970ee9aa6e
confirmations
556974
spent
true